Canada close to nuclear deal with India - WAAYTV.com - Huntsville

“Increased collaboration with India’s civilian nuclear energy market will allow Canadian companies to benefit from greater access to one of the world’s largest and fastest expanding economies,” Harper said during a meeting with India’s Prime Minister Dr. Manmohan Singh, following the Commonwealth … It was a turning point for Canada, which stopped nuclear co-operation with India in 1974 after its government used plutonium from a Canadian reactor to build an atomic bomb. …
